  2. You need to go to commissionjunction.com and sign up for an account with them. After that you’ll be able to make money by referring people to eBay via special links that have tracking codes in them (which you’ll get from cj). If the people you send to eBay via your links buy stuff or sign up for an account, you make money. I think they pay something like $25 per signup, and something like 40-50% of their fees on item that are sold. Overall eBay is a real good company to market for.
